Water Curtailment Report 8/12/21

Molalla Water Curtailment Update - 8/12/21 at 8:00 AM. Yesterday (8/11) the City used 1,442,000 gallons of Drinking Water. This figure compares to the 1,375,200 gallons used the previous day. Average usage over the past 7 days is 1,280,114 gallons. The Molalla River at Canby Gauge Station is flowing at 68 cfs (cubic feet per second) this morning. The Molalla River 7 day average is 68.28 cfs. The Water Tanks are full, providing roughly 3,000,000 gallons of storage, and the plant is able to run at full capacity. This means the City is able to meet domestic water (drinking water) demands at this time. NOTE: The average water usage for last winter (Nov 2020 thru Feb 2021) was approximately 827,000 gallons of Drinking Water per day. Please conserve water.
